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Moreton (Merseyside) to Cardiff Central start from as little as £31.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Moreton (Merseyside) to Cardiff Central are available for £92.80 one way

Station Facilities

Moreton (Merseyside) station is designed with ease in mind, offering step-free access throughout, making it accessible to everyone. The station’s Ticket Office is open daily, serving as the hub for any assistance you might need, including ticket collection for those who prefer booking online. Unfortunately, there are no ticket machines available, so it’s best to plan your ticket purchase through alternative methods.

Although there are no refreshment facilities or shops, there are seating areas where you can wait comfortably until your train arrives. Concerned about safety? Rest assured, the presence of CCTV ensures continuous security within the station. Plus, if you’re bringing along your bicycle, secure storage spaces are available.

Accessibility and Support Services

Moreton (Merseyside) is committed to ensuring every traveller can navigate the station easily. With ramps available for train access and staff help points ready for any guidance, you’re in safe hands. There’s an induction loop for those with hearing impairments. While there is no designated area for luggage storage, staff are available for assistance throughout the day.

If you need to get to the station by car, accessible car parking operated by Merseyrail offers 34 spots, including two accessible spaces. The cherry on top? Parking is free, so you can enjoy stress-free arrival and departures. Though taxi rank facilities aren’t available, the local area provides easy alternatives for onward travel.

Facilities and Amenities

Cardiff Central station is designed with the comfort of travelers in mind. With ticket office hours stretching from early morning until late at night, and the presence of both regular and accessible ticket machines, purchasing and collecting tickets is straightforward. If you've opted to buy your tickets online, you can conveniently collect them from the ticket machines.

The station is fully accessible with step-free access across all platforms, making travel simple for everyone, including those with mobility issues. You'll also find helpful staff available almost 24/7 to assist with any inquiries. With multiple waiting rooms open daily from 6 am to 10 pm, you can relax comfortably while awaiting your train. And if you're looking to pass the time, Cardiff Central boasts shops like WHSmith, and various vending machines for hot and cold refreshments.

Connectivity and Travel Links

This bustling station is well-connected to local and regional transport services. You can access the taxi ranks located on Saunders Road or take advantage of the newly opened Cardiff Bus Interchange at Central Square, which enhances your options for onward journey convenience. For those needing to catch a flight, the T9 Airport Express coach service is just a stone's throw away, offering a direct link to Cardiff Airport in about 40 minutes.
